[QUOTE="BigRod, post: 4153843, member: 4716"] Look up Melton Hill Bill he's a local Musky guide out there. I live on the lake and know of a few spots to target them, if the steam plant is running, that's a good place to start, also check out the cove when you come into carbide park, i think they call it clark center park now. it's the cove that you drive by when you first come into the gate at the park. it's a couple miles up river if you put in at the park. Good luck they are the fish of a thousand cast [/QUOTE]
